Storming on Lake Erie out of Buffalo

Sailing during storm on Lake Erie. We departed Buffalo on the Sunday, September 24, 2006, morning and after 8 hours of beating to the weather we decided to turn back. During that time we managed to do just 8NM away frm Buffalo.
